Handover for weekly eng sync — session-token refresh bug in Lanthorn Auth. Tokens refreshed within 30 seconds of expiry occasionally reused a stale signing key, causing intermittent 401s on the Drossel gateway. Root cause: the key-rotation cache in refresh workers lagged one cycle behind. Fix is merged behind the `rotglue` flag; Pemberton owns rollout. To access the incident replay environment, use the recovery passphrase below.

strongbox words: istwyn-normir-silwyn-ulaius-istwyn

## Hermetic Build Migration — Data Stores

Quick update for the sync: we're moving the Larkspin build onto the hermetic toolchain this sprint. Network access is blocked at build time, so anything that used to ping the metadata store mid-compile now reads from a pinned snapshot. The snapshot job runs nightly and writes into the staging store. For local testing, point the snapshot tool at the staging instance using the connection string below.

primary connection of yagep-kahip = redis://giliel_svc:zYiKsLL2PLpfPL@db-348f.xolmarsys.corp:5432/fenwyn

Ticket: Staging env misconfigured for Siftgate bloom filter

The bloom layer in front of the Pellet KV store is rejecting all lookups in staging because the env file was copied from the dev template without credentials. False-positive tuning values are fine; only the auth line is missing. To unblock the weekly demo, the Pellet admission secret must be set on the following line.

env line for yaguf-fajop: LEDGER_TOKEN13=fb08984397349

Hey Mirelle — handing off the Taxrill lookup cache before I'm out. TTL is 6 hours, keyed by region code; the Ostrava-variant rates refresh nightly. Watch the warmup job, it double-fires if the scheduler hiccups (known bug, ticket filed). If the cache store locks up and you need to reset the encrypted snapshot, unlock it with the recovery passphrase below.

vault phrase of taweg-kafof = oliax-zorael